What are some examples of excellent customer service? Providing excellent customer service comes from having excellent interpersonal skills. Therefore, examples of excellent customer service involve any time a person employs these interpersonal skills. Some of these skills include communication, listening, assertiveness, self-control and positive thinking.

How do you provide excellent customer service? To provide excellent customer service, a company must have representatives that are knowledgeable about the products and their services. They must know the product well enough to answer even the most specific questions from customers. With this as a basis, companies can begin to offer superior customer service.

How to get a better customer feedback? Distributing surveys is one of the best ways to collect feedback from your customers. Simply posting a link to a survey in a blog post, Facebook status, a Tweet, an Instagram post, or whatever other methods of sharing on any social media platform will increase its visibility and guarantee that a bunch of people will take that survey.

How do you describe excellent customer service? Excellent customer service includes treating your customers with respect and helping them solve their problems efficiently. Customer service tactics may differ based on industry. The ideal experience is smooth, pleasant and memorable for the customer.

Companies often focus solely on customer experience, forgetting the actual driver for an excellent customer journey – their employees. According to the 2016 CXEvolution study by MaritzCX, “customer-centric companies are three times more successful at driving significant financial improvement and customer retention than companies that are not customer-centric”.
